        In Global Resources Tab, There is no item for WDT, Has it changed procedure of initial WDT setting ? (PSoC:8C29466-24PXI, Vista 32bit)

This obviously is an error in the internal chip-property-definition for the CY8C29466 and should be fixed asap! I found at least one example for a device where the Watchdog Timer could be enabled. Since the 29466 HAS got a WDT it was clearly only forgotten. I'm going to file a tech case.

Hi,

   

This is a bug really. Thanks for reporting this to us. It will be fixed in the next release of PSoC Designer. Any more feedback/suggestions are welcome.

   

As a workaround, following macro can be executing in application code if WatchDog is needed:

M8C_EnableWatchDog ;

   

More information of how this can be done and Clocks and Global Resources configuration of PSoC1 devices can be found in AN32200.  http://www.cypress.com/?rID=2773
